Output 3e3c21c1506fe222d9525a69f661ab2200a2970bf53504dc428219d23bc9618a:0

value
272390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ba9246e3909eb81b7972e2ca55c68615b04619 OP_EQUAL
address
3Fca8uiW7HeG9uUoZkPNj8i59peT6Bh7jD
transaction
3e3c21c1506fe222d9525a69f661ab2200a2970bf53504dc428219d23bc9618a
spent
true